El Ocho acquires the rights of LazyTown, Peppa Pig and Canal Cocina

El Ocho Licencias y Promociones has acquired, at national level, in the first quarter of 2010 the rights of representation of LazyTown, Peppa Pig and Canal Cocina.

logo-lazy-town

El Ocho Licencias y Promociones relaunches Lazy Town. After several years of backgroind in the area of licensing, the Agency wanted to bet on this children´s series. The owner is in negotiations to have the support of the Ministry of Health and the major companies to participate in numerous promotional sport campaigns. Already there is an agreement of collaboration with the Spanish Association Against Cancer (AECC).

Lazy Town is beginning to be placed in the top spot in the ranking of the most sought licenses for child audiences. At the present time LazyTown is in discussions with the major companies in the toy sector also this series counts with the support of the television.

From Lazy Town, want to capture the attention of children and families to encourage them to keep a healthy lifestyle, and they have created a package of seven simple rules, easy and fun to follow.

The series, which is aimed at children 2-8 years old, has 52 episodes of 26 minutes, and currently broadcasts in La 2, Clan TV and Disney Channel. And for the next back to school are expected 26 new episodes called Lazy Town Extra co-produced by TVE.

Another series that reaches Spain and Portugal is Peppa Pig. Exported from England and awarded with the BAFTA award 2008, Peppa Pig is broadcast in Cataluña's Regional channel TV3 and in Portugal is broadcast in RPT and next September at Canal Panda.

Peppa Pig is being an unprecedented success in Portugal. Because of this El Ocho begin to develop its program of licensing in this country. One of the leading toy companies is in negotiations to sign important agreements. After the agreement is signed, they want to launch the entire line of toys of LazyTown. Also a leading company acquires DVD rights of Peppa Pig.

Regarding the development of licensing in Spain, El Ocho is waiting to be broadcast nationally. Currently this process is in negotiations. Peppa Pig has 130 chapters in five minutes each and a Christmas special of 11 minutes.
